Ringfort (Rath), Gortnacarriga, Co. Kerry

A few metres inside this Kerry ringfort, the ground rises in a low circular mound near the centre, and a slight ridge runs north to south just beside it.

These are not dramatic features, and that is precisely what makes them interesting. They are the kind of details that survive quietly for over a thousand years inside the earthwork enclosure that once defined someone's home, their livestock yard, their immediate world.

A ringfort, or rath, is an enclosed settlement type common across early medieval Ireland, typically dating from roughly 500 to 1000 AD. They were built as family farmsteads, the surrounding bank offering a degree of security and a clear boundary between domestic space and the wider landscape. This example at Gortnacarriga sits in pasture on a gentle south-west facing slope, roughly 90 metres east of the Killarney to Tralee road. The enclosure measures approximately 46 metres east to west and 42 metres north to south, with an earth and stone bank that still stands around 1.4 metres above the interior surface. The bank has been breached in several places over the centuries, and the interior itself slopes gently down towards the south-west. In the north-east quadrant, the remains of a hut site are still detectable, a faint echo of whatever structure once occupied that corner of the enclosure. There may have been an entrance at the south-east. An 1894 Ordnance Survey map records an outer ring of hachures running from the north-west to south-south-east, which could indicate a second, outer bank or fosse, a defining ditch, that has since been largely lost. Such double-banked raths were generally associated with households of higher social standing in early medieval Ireland, though whether that outer feature survives in any meaningful form on the ground today is unclear.
